DRINKING COFFEE LATE AT NIGHT
  • Drinking coffee late in the evening not only does it affect your weight, but also harms your sleep.
  • It is best to consume caffeine 6 hours prior to going to bed.
  • Scientists also link the consumption of chlorogenic acid, which is found in coffee, to weight gain.
  • Try to substitute coffee with herbal tea, or even better, warm water.
NOT GETTING ENOUGH SLEEP
  • The healthiest amount of sleep is between 7 to 8 hours of sleep per night.
  • If it is less than that on a regular basis, it may cause some health problems.
  • Studies have proven that there is a link between negative changes in metabolism and sleep deprivation.
  • Another decisive factor might be that not having enough sleep leads to fatigue, thus having less physical activity.

USING ELECTRONIC DEVICES IN THE EVENING
  • Studies confirm that using electronic devices that emit blue light before sleep is linked to sleep deprivation and eventual weight gain.
  • These devices interfere with the body's production of melatonin, which is a hormone responsible for regulating sleep cycles.
  • Instead of browsing social media on your phone before going to bed, choose to read an interesting book in print or listen to some relaxing music.
SETTING THE ALARM TOO LATE
  • Believe it or not, researchers say that people who are exposed to bright light earlier in the morning have a lower body mass index than those who are exposed to light later.
  • It is proven that even 20 to 30 minutes of natural outdoor light affects your body mass index.
